Audiologist | Hartford Hospital | Hartford, CT

    https://hartfordhospital.org/health-wellness/health-resources/health-library/detail?id=ug3098
    They use a variety of devices to measure hearing and the type and extent of hearing loss. Most states require a license, and the requirements for the license vary. Typically, a doctorate or master's degree in audiology is required. Some audiologists hold a Certificate of Clinical Competence in Audiology (CCC-A), which requires additional training.
